waitress had never heard of the aperitif i ordered (which was literally on the placemat in front of me), so i figured i'd be safe and just go with an Aperol Spritz. the girl looked at me like i was an alien and couldn't even pronounce the word "Aperol". at that point i just told her to bring me an Old Fashioned and be done with it, which wasn't half bad, albeit a touch under-sweetened and garnished with an orange wedge and one of those neon sweet "maraschino" cherries that you get on a hot fudge sundae. however, my vanilla Coke, pickle and coleslaw, huge open-faced Reuben sandwich and (underseasoned) potato salad (with giant chunks of raw carrot in it) were all decent. i got a rice pudding to go, but when i got home to eat it, it had almost no flavor, all the rice grains were broken and the rice itself was NOT fully cooked. at least their onion rings are still legendary, as are their Christmas decorations.
